Digital training to help health workers manage malaria in Angola

Angola continues to struggle to strengthen its health sector. One key component of the USAID’s Health for All (HFA) project is to strengthen capacity of health workers in public facilities, which is traditionally performed through two methods in Angola, in-classroom training of health workers, and supervision of health workers in health facilities during service delivery. USAID/Angola and the U.S. President’s Malaria Initiative launched an innovative eLearning platform called Kassai in June 2020 in collaboration with Angola Ministry of Health. The Kassai is a Moodle-based e-Learning platform that was customized for use in the Angolan health sector by an Angolan digital innovation company, Appy People. Video credit: USAID/Angola
